Did you know that
the word dove is mentioned in the bible thirty one times?
Everybody probably knows the story of Noah and the ark,
|
6 And
it came to pass at the end of forty days, that Noah opened the
window of the ark which he had made:
7 And
he sent forth a raven, which went forth to
and fro, until the waters were dried up from off the earth.
8 Also
he sent forth a dove from him, to see if the waters were abated from
off the face of the ground;
9 But
the dove found no rest for the sole of her foot, and she returned
unto him into the ark, for the waters were on the face of the whole
earth: then he put forth his hand, and took her, and pulled her in
unto him into the ark.
10 And
he stayed yet other seven days; and again he sent forth the dove out
of the ark;
11 And
the dove came in to him in the evening; and, lo, in her mouth was an
olive leaf pluckt off: so Noah knew that the waters were abated from
off the earth.
12 And
he stayed yet other seven days; and sent forth the dove; which
returned not again unto him any more. |
But not everybody knows the story of when Jesus was baptized that a dove
descended
upon him.
|
21 Now
when all the people were baptized, it came to pass, that Jesus also
being baptized, and praying, the heaven was opened,
22 And
the Holy Ghost descended in a bodily shape like a dove upon him, and
a voice came from heaven, which said, Thou art my beloved Son; in
thee I am well pleased. |
So in remembrance of those that has gone on before us we
release these doves,
signifying the name of the Father, the Son and the Holy
Spirit.
